+//
+// This file implements the Windows-specific parts of the JobserverClient class.
+// On Windows, the jobserver is implemented using a named semaphore.
+//
+//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
+
+#include "llvm/Support/Windows/WindowsSupport.h"
+#include <atomic>
+#include <cassert>
+
+namespace llvm {
+/// The constructor for the Windows jobserver client. It attempts to open a
+/// handle to an existing named semaphore, the name of which is provided by
+/// GNU make in the --jobserver-auth argument. If the semaphore is opened
+/// successfully, the client is marked as initialized.
+JobserverClientImpl::JobserverClientImpl(const JobserverConfig &Config) {
+ Semaphore = (void *)::OpenSemaphoreA(SEMAPHORE_MODIFY_STATE | SYNCHRONIZE,
+ FALSE, Config.Path.c_str());
+ if (Semaphore != nullptr)
+ IsInitialized = true;
+}
+
+/// The destructor closes the handle to the semaphore, releasing the resource.
+JobserverClientImpl::~JobserverClientImpl() {
+ if (Semaphore != nullptr)
+ ::CloseHandle((HANDLE)Semaphore);
+}
+
+/// Tries to acquire a job slot. The first call always returns the implicit
+/// slot. Subsequent calls use a non-blocking wait on the semaphore
+/// (`WaitForSingleObject` with a timeout of 0). If the wait succeeds, the
+/// semaphore's count is decremented, and an explicit job slot is acquired.
+/// If the wait times out, it means no slots are available, and an invalid
+/// slot is returned.
+JobSlot JobserverClientImpl::tryAcquire() {
+ if (!IsInitialized)
+ return JobSlot();
+
+ // First, grant the implicit slot.
+ if (HasImplicitSlot.exchange(false, std::memory_order_acquire)) {
+ return JobSlot::createImplicit();
+ }
+
+ // Try to acquire a slot from the semaphore without blocking.
+ if (::WaitForSingleObject((HANDLE)Semaphore, 0) == WAIT_OBJECT_0) {
+ // The explicit token value is arbitrary on Windows, as the semaphore
+ // count is the real resource.
+ return JobSlot::createExplicit(1);
+ }
+
+ return JobSlot(); // Invalid slot
+}
+
+/// Releases a job slot back to the pool. If the slot is implicit, it simply
+/// resets a flag. For an explicit slot, it increments the semaphore's count
+/// by one using `ReleaseSemaphore`, making the slot available to other
+/// processes.
+void JobserverClientImpl::release(JobSlot Slot) {
+ if (!IsInitialized || !Slot.isValid())
+ return;
+
+ if (Slot.isImplicit()) {
+ [[maybe_unused]] bool was_already_released =
+ HasImplicitSlot.exchange(true, std::memory_order_release);
+ assert(!was_already_released && "Implicit slot released twice");
+ return;
+ }
+
+ // Release the slot by incrementing the semaphore count.
+ (void)::ReleaseSemaphore((HANDLE)Semaphore, 1, NULL);
+}
+} // namespace llvm
